|  | Tidbits on Meridian. Population 36,000, between the two major population centers Boise and Nampa. It has two Albertsons food centers and a Home Depot. Meridian also has various gas stations to serve you better and plenty of fine restaurants for your hunger needs. Also known as the Hub of the treasure valley.
